Learners who abuse drugs face severe challenges in educational engagement. In Vihiga County, Kenya, research involving secondary school learners, principals, teacher counsellors, and a county quality assurance officer assessed the impact of substance misuse on school participation alongside existing school mitigation strategies. Over 80 to 90 percent of respondents linked drug abuse to irregular attendance, classroom inactivity, failure to adhere to routines, and poor peer relationships. Quantitative analysis confirmed significant associations between substance abuse and multiple participation metrics. To respond, secondary schools routinely provide guidance counselling, awareness talks, peer counselling, and prevention clubs. Nevertheless, essential interventions such as rehabilitation referrals, sensitisation programmes for new learners, and formal policy enforcement remain inconsistently applied. School interventions currently exhibit strong institutional commitment but suffer from uneven coverage and limited evaluation of outcomes.
Substance abuse undermines foundational educational outcomes by degrading school attendance, peer connections, and academic focus. By identifying key weaknesses in current school-based responses, such as inconsistent rehabilitation referral pathways and absent outcome assessments, this evidence helps educators and policymakers target resources effectively to protect vulnerable learners and maintain educational continuity.

Drug abuse can weaken learners’ attendance, classroom engagement, adherence to routines, peer relationships, and participation in co-curricular activities. Schools respond through awareness, counselling, peer programmes, policies, monitoring, referral, and collaboration, but the coverage and practical effectiveness of these measures can vary. This study determined the effect of drug abuse on school participation and examined the effectiveness of mitigation strategies used among secondary school learners in Vihiga County, Kenya. Social Learning Theory and the Person–Environment Fit Model guided the study. A pragmatist paradigm and convergent mixed-methods design were adopted. The target population comprised 29,240 Form Three learners, 112 principals, 112 teacher counsellors, and one County Quality Assurance and Standards Officer. Stratified and simple random sampling selected 395 learners, purposive sampling selected 12 principals and 12 counsellors, and saturated sampling included the County officer. Usable data were obtained from 387 learners and all 25 institutional respondents through questionnaires, semi-structured interviews, and document analysis. Quantitative data were analysed using frequencies, percentages, and chi-square tests of independence, while qualitative evidence was analysed thematically. Most respondents reported that learners who abused drugs did not attend school regularly (90.4%), did not participate actively in class (82.2%), did not follow school routines (92.2%), and did not relate well with peers (85.5%). Chi-square results showed significant associations between drug abuse and attendance, extracurricular participation, class participation, routine adherence, problem solving, and maintenance of responsibilities (p < .01). Guidance and counselling (86.3%), awareness talks (80.9%), peer counselling (68.2%), and prevention clubs (65.9%) were commonly reported. However, treatment or rehabilitation referral (45.5%), sensitization of new learners (46.0%), and formal policy implementation were less consistent. The study concludes that drug abuse is significantly associated with reduced school participation, while school interventions show broad institutional commitment but uneven coverage and limited outcome evaluation. Schools should strengthen confidential counselling, referral pathways, peer-led prevention, attendance monitoring, parental engagement, community surveillance, and systematic evaluation of programme outcomes.
